My route to Micronesia could have been worse, that’s for sure. I left Calgary, changed planes in Colorado, then had about seven hours and a good nights sleep in Honolulu, Hawaii. Anyone who works with me, knows how much I cherish my airplane naps. Well, of course, on any of the flights to I remember taking off. I did however, wake up just enough to hear the best announcement I have ever heard on a flight. The attendant came over the PA and said the following: excuse me passengers, could you please close the door to the washroom when you are finished using it. This will greatly increase the comfort of those people seated in that area. Amazing.

I had no sooner put down my bags before I was out in a taxi van getting a tour of the island. I had a gent named Harold meet me at my hotel and when he asked me where I wanted to go, I told him away from all the people and buildings. I was very surprised at how big Honolulu was and you could compare that downtown with any other downtown in North America. We went to some amazing view points of the coast and downtown, I saw Waikiki beach and all the major hotels in that area but we spent the most amount of time was in the National Memorial Cemetery of the Pacific. Truuk Lagoon diving exists because of WWII and to be able to visit this place and put in perspective the history I was going to emerge myself into was a fantastic opportunity. This is an amazingly peaceful place where you can’t help but reflect on your own lives but mostly the lives lost during these horrific battles. So many people.
